Several days had passed since the end of the conference, and the Sky City had drifted above an unknown desert.
News came from various nations: the Four-Tails and the Six-Tails had been captured by the Akatsuki, and even the Two-Tails couldn't escape. The Akatsuki's capture efficiency had skyrocketed—it was far quicker than before. Reportedly, six members involved in these captures had the Rinnegan, and the only known ability among them was that the lead ninja could pull people toward him with some unknown power.
Jiraiya, now Hokage in Konoha, had confirmed that Amegakure (Hidden Rain Village) might be the Akatsuki's stronghold. Though he'd typically go alone for a mission like this, his status as Hokage meant he couldn't be so reckless anymore.
At this time, Kakashi's Team 7 volunteered for the mission to gather intelligence, hoping to contribute to the effort to eliminate Akatsuki. They also requested support from Zixu.
Zixu agreed without hesitation. He couldn't leave right away, and Rosinante was maintaining the Sky City's barrier. Karin and the others had been promised some rest—if things went on like this, there would only be one path left.
"What kind of clone should I create this time?" Zixu pondered. "Haki alone can form a complete combat system. Let's focus on that and integrate it with taijutsu like Gentle Fist (Jūken)."
He concentrated, forming a shadow clone.
A classical-looking man appeared, dressed in black and blue training gear resembling traditional Chinese clothing. Standing still like a tall pine, the clone's calm eyes exuded restrained power—a sword with no edge, fully retracted.
Zixu nodded in satisfaction. This clone, reinforced with Armament Haki (Busoshoku Haki), would be sturdier. What happened last time shouldn't repeat.
After giving it some instructions, Zixu sent the clone down.
Having handled that, Zixu walked to the edge of Sky City. Looking down, all he saw were clouds at an altitude of 10,000 meters. The entire floating city drifted above a sea of white clouds, like a small boat on a heavenly ocean.
Warm sunlight fell upon his cheeks. Zixu took a deep breath, suppressed his chakra and abilities to the minimum by pressing specific acupoints, activated his Observation Haki (Kenbunshoku Haki) to the limit—and jumped.
Eyes completely shut, he relied solely on his Observation Haki to sense altitude. Any distraction could mean death.
The clouds, like layers of gauze, brushed gently past his face. The temperature plummeted. His skin, alternating between warmth and freezing cold, prickled with goosebumps. The wind felt like a flurry of cold blades lashing his face, but his defense held.
Zixu adjusted his form as he plummeted faster and faster. His Observation Haki screamed warnings. His senses felt like they were being stabbed. Still, he didn't open his eyes.
Just before impact, his body wrapped in Armament Haki, he struck the desert below—hard. The pain screamed through his bones. The impact was brutal, his limbs numb, organs rattled. But it worked.
"Damn, that hurt like hell." Zixu groaned from the bottom of the crater.
Despite protecting himself with Haki and manipulating the wind to soften the fall at the last second, the damage was still serious. Ironically, his most severe injury came from his own insane training method.
Lying in the crater, he stared at the sky.
The Sky City always floated above the clouds. With the help of Water-style users like Hyuga Chinano and Ice-style ninjas like Haku, it remained hidden amidst endless cloud seas.
"Hmm? Why does it feel soft beneath me?"
Zixu shifted. Though still a little numb, he could move.
He stood and stomped his foot. A hollow sound echoed.
"Hollow? There's something underneath." He glanced around—just ruins and yellow sand. It looked like a dead land, abandoned and forgotten.
"A country ruined by war?" he muttered.
Wars were endless in the shinobi world. Cities vanished all the time. This might be one of those forgotten casualties.
Still, something strange tickled his senses.
He crushed the stone beneath his feet—and fell with it.
The underground stench hit him instantly: rot, mildew, and decay.
But what Zixu sensed next was far more shocking.
There was something ahead that shined like a blinding light in the darkness, a thing that absolutely shouldn't exist here.
"Dong-dong... dong-dong..."
A heartbeat echoed, steady and eerie.
Footsteps—quick, panicked—resounded nearby.
Zixu held his breath and concealed his chakra, inching closer to the sound.
The heartbeat grew louder, each thump pounding into his ears. The footsteps grew closer too—as if someone were being hunted.
Rounding a wall, he saw a figure stop.
"They chased us even here?" The voice was gritty, sharp, like sandpaper grinding metal.
"So, he's being chased." Zixu judged but didn't reveal himself.
Then, without hesitation, the figure began a ritual.
That's when Zixu saw something impossible.
One of his own dragon scales—utterly drained of energy—lay among the ritual items. It looked like a shell, abandoned after years of decay.
